AB From may/2006 to april/2007 a monthly sampling of the recharge conditions and main hydrogeochemicalparameters was conducted at a network of dripping points within Canelobre cave (Alicante). Speleothemsare fed by a combination of seepage and fracture water, indicating that the system consists of a matrix witha network of discontinuities (fractures or conduits) with different characteristics. Control of Mg/Ca and Sr/Ca indexes has provided data to identify several water infiltration processes into the vadose zone underarid conditions: ranges of flow-through times to drips, prior calcite precipitation and dissolution of Mgand Sr. Both indexes depend on the discharge intensity, though their variability adjust to a spatial frameworkdetermined by cave geomorphology (grade of karst development, stratigraphic contacts and fractures) YR 2007 FD 2007 LK http://hdl.handle.net/10272/8381 UL http://hdl.handle.net/10272/8381 LA spa DS Repositorio Institucional de la Universidad de Huelva RD 30 may 2026
